Oogles n Googles is a family-friendly entertainment center in Carmel, IN, offering a variety of activities and games for all ages.
With a focus on fun and creativity, Oogles n Googles provides a unique and engaging experience for visitors looking to enjoy quality time together.
Generated from their business information